Output ebe3fcdfbf72206ae3c176c875bc538c53c7b4be854cf560cd95d2c7b7d52a87:0

value
651778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ad56b4ca3c22ce2a5881a33bd5d6b1701855448 OP_EQUAL
address
3CtW2ZwXPLp6K4YMGTmtqNcCCz5egwHU8x
transaction
ebe3fcdfbf72206ae3c176c875bc538c53c7b4be854cf560cd95d2c7b7d52a87
confirmations
120553
spent
true